
BC-Ni307-3(NiCrFe-3)
Product Application
● Suitable for welding atomic furnace pressure vessels and chemical tanks
● Welding of nickel chromium iron composite alloy and surfacing of steel
● Welding of Steel and Nickel Alloy
● Welding nickel chromium iron alloy
Characteristics and advantages
● Ni70Cr15 heat-resistant alloy welding rod with low hydrogen sodium coating
● Weld metal has good crack resistance performance
● Has good oxidation resistance and corrosion resistance
● Maintain the integrity and stability of materials under high temperature conditions
Compliant with standards
● GB/T 13814 ENi6182
● AWS A5.11 ENiCrFe-3
● ISO 14172-E Ni 6182
Chemical composition of deposited metal
C | Mn | Si | P | S | Ni | |
Standard value | ≤0.1 | 5.0-10.0 | ≤1.0 | ≤0.02 | ≤0.015 | ≤60.0 |
Example value | 0.041 | 6.45 | 0.32 | 0.005 | 0.011 | 68.5 |
Cr | Cu | Fe | Nb | Ta | Ti | |
Standard value | 13.0-17.0 | ≤0.5 | ≤10.0 | 1.0-3.5 | ≤0.3 | ≤1.0 |
Example value | 15.9 | 0.01 | 7.54 | 1.55 | 0.005 | 0.10 |
Mechanical properties of deposited metal
Tensile Strength Rm(MPa) | Yield Strength ReL (MPa) | Elongation after fracture A(%) | -196℃Impact Energy KV2(J) | |||||
Standard value | ≥550 | ≥360 | ≥27 | — | ||||
Example value | 635 | 395 | 43.5 | 105 |
